§ 31-19-15-1 — Effect upon duties, obligations, and rights of biological parents; parent-child relationship terminated

Text

(a)Except as provided in section 2 of this chapter or IC 31-19-16, if the biological parents of an adopted person are alive, the biological parents are:
(1)relieved of all legal duties and obligations to the adopted child; and
(2)divested of all rights with respect to the child; and the parent-child relationship is terminated after the adoption unless the parent-child relationship was terminated by an earlier court action, operation of law, or otherwise.
(b)The obligation to support the adopted person continues until the entry of the adoption decree. The entry of the adoption decree does not extinguish the obligation to pay past due child support owed for the adopted person before the entry of the adoption decree. [Pre-1997 Recodification Citation: 31-3-1-9(a).]
